Sisie, just my guess from the pic, but all the shock in the world won't help your problem. I've seen the same distribution of 'debris' on pool floors many times, and it's a problem with the filtration (either the multiport or the filter itself). IMHO what's happening is that the debris is bypassing the filter and returning directly to the pool.
